The characterisation of T7 polymerase amplifier devices and arsenic repressor/promoter combinations in B. subtilis for use in the development of an Arsenic Biosensor. (360G-Wellcome-202145_Z_16_Z)

Harnessing the natural arsenic sensing ability of the bacteria Bacillus subtilis, it has been possible to engineer strains that synthesise a visible pink chromoprotein at different threshold concentrations of arsenic (10, 50 and 200 ppb), corresponding to WHO and government-recommended guidelines for arsenic levels. The constructed strains now require extensive characterisation of individual components of the system. This project aims to characterise the signal-amplifying devices for T7 polymerase and split T7 polymerase, along with several arsenic repressor-promoter combinations. This will be achieved by transferring the desired devices into a pre-designed dual reporter strain of B. subtilis by PCR/molecular cloning/chromosomal integration. The production of fluorescent reporters in plate reader assays for different arsenic concentrations, will allow characterisation of the device output. The performance of these parts and devices across a range of arsenic concentrations and incubation regimes (temperatures, fluctuating temperatures etc.) will also be addressed. The development of an Arsenic Biosensor would effectively address the global issue of arsenic contamination of ground water in a low cost, accessible and sensitive manor.
